Чистый код. Три книги о программировании для новичков и специалистов

22 мая 2020, 20:43

Книги из этой подборки будут интересны как тем, кто только делает первые шаги в программировании, так и тем, кто давно работает в этой области

Если вы давно мечтали освоить новую профессию или хотите улучшить свои знания, предлагаем замечательную подборку книг об IT. Во-первых, сейчас знания в этой сфере очень востребованы и эти книги могут стать вашим первым шагом к изменению профессии. Во-вторых, вполне вероятно, что опыт именно этого автора поможет вам написать собственную непревзойденную игру или стать профи в создании потрясающе функциональных и удобных сайтов. Поэтому выбирайте книгу и вперед к новым знаниям.

Видео дня

JavaScript для дітей. Веселий вступ до програмування, Ник Морган

starylev.com.ua
Фото: starylev.com.ua

JavaScript – это язык программирования, который делает Интернет удивительным, ваши любимые веб-сайты интерактивными, а онлайн-игры веселыми. JavaScript для детей – это книга, обучающая основам программирования на простых примерах с забавными иллюстрациями. Вы начнете с базы, такой как работа со строками, массивами, а затем перейдете к более сложным темам, например, построение систем и рисование графики.

Эта книга сделает из вас лучшего программиста

Параллельно вы попробуете писать игры, а также научитесь создавать функции для организации и повторного использования кода, писать и изменять HTML для создания динамичных веб-страниц, использовать DOM и jQuery, чтобы ваши веб-страницы реагировали на ввод пользователей, использовать элемент Canvas для рисования и анимации графики.

С помощью наглядных примеров, как, например, подпрыгивающие шары, анимированные пчелы и гоночные машины, вы действительно можете увидеть, что вы программируете. Каждая глава связана с предыдущей, то есть обучение линейное. Эта книга вдохновит вас создавать собственные удивительные программы. Она подойдет как детям, так и взрослым, которые только собираются изучать JavaScript.

Искусственный интеллект с примерами на Python, Пратик Джоши

williamspublishing.com
Фото: williamspublishing.com

Книга идеальна для начинающих, которые хотят познакомиться с Python и поиграть с кодом, а также пригодится опытным программистам, которые хотят использовать методы искусственного интеллекта в имеющихся наборах технологий. Что вы будете знать после прочтения? Вы познакомитесь с различными методами классификации и регрессии, с понятием кластеризации и принципами использования ее для автоматического сегментирования данных, увидите, как создать интеллектуальную систему рекомендаций, поймете логическое программирование и способы его применения, сможете построить автоматические системы распознавания речи и разработать игры с помощью искусственного интеллекта. Почему это интересно? Искусственный интеллект становится все более актуальным в современном мире. Используя мощность алгоритмов, вы сможете создавать приложения, которые взаимодействуют с окружающим миром, строя интеллектуальные системы рекомендации, автоматические системы распознавания речи и тому подобное. Узнайте, как принимать обоснованные решения, какие алгоритмы использовать и как их применять к реальным сценариям. Эта практическая книга охватывает целый ряд тем, включая прогностическую аналитику.

Чистий код. Створення і рефакторинг за допомогою Agile, Роберт Мартин

fabulabook.com
Фото: fabulabook.com

Даже плохой код будет функционировать. Но если он несовершенен, то может серьезно навредить организации. Ежегодно из-за плохо написанного кода теряется бесчисленное количество часов и значительные ресурсы. Но так быть не должно. Эксперт по программному обеспечению Роберт Мартин объединился со своими коллегами из Object Mentor, чтобы узнать про их лучшую практику очистки кода «на лету» и написать о ней. Эта книга сделает из вас ценного мастера программного обеспечения и лучшего программиста.

poster
Дайджест главных новостей
Бесплатная email-рассылка только лучших материалов от редакторов NV
Рассылка отправляется с понедельника по пятницу

Автор позаботился и о практической составляющей: он показывает коды и предлагает читателю определить, что в этом коде правильно и что с ним не так. В книге три части. Первая описывает принципы, закономерности и практику написания чистого кода. Вторая часть состоит из нескольких кейсов каждый раз более сложного уровня. Третья часть содержит данные, собранные при создании тематических исследований. Эта книга является обязательной для любого разработчика, инженера программного обеспечения, менеджера проектов, руководителя команды или системного аналитика, заинтересованного в создании лучшего кода.

Книги из этой подборки будут интересны как тем, кто только делает первые шаги в программировании, так и тем, кто давно работает в отрасли. Новички убедятся, что понятие JavaScript, Python и Agile на самом деле не так страшны, как кажутся, а опытные специалисты найдут новые фишки и ознакомятся с интересными кейсами.

Присоединяйтесь к нашему телеграм-каналу Мнения НВ

Больше блогов здесь

Показать ещё новости
Радіо NV
X